CPU-Z

SiSoft Sandra
Sandra is a software collection of synthetic benchmarks
that will give us a basic idea as to what a system is capable of. It should be noted that SiSoft numbers change depending on what version you have installed, these were
recorded using Sandra Professional Version 2004.10.9.133



Cachemem
Cachemem is a synthetic benchmark used to test bandwidth and latency.

Synthetic Conclusion
Nothing new to report here, 3200+ processors running at the same speed have the same basic CPU power. Memory of course is considerably higher due to the dual channel memory controller.
